1

Computational Engineering Jobs in California (NOW HIRING)

PhD in computational physics, applied mathematics, computational engineering, or a closely related field * Deep expertise in numerical PDE methods: FEM, FVM, or BEM - weak formulations, quadrature ...

PhD in computational physics, applied mathematics, computational engineering, or a closely related field * Deep expertise in numerical PDE methods: FEM, FVM, or BEM -- weak formulations, quadrature ...

Stay up to date with advancements in computational techniques, programming languages, and physical theories to apply state-of-the-art methodologies to projects. * Contribute to academic papers ...

... engineering fundamentals and experience working with bioinformatics tools and pipelines • Working knowledge of statistical and machine learning methods applied to biological data (e.g. regression ...

D. in Materials Science, Computational Engineering, AI/ML, or related field. Technical Expertise: * Strong proficiency in Python and ML frameworks (PyTorch, TensorFlow). * Experience with generative ...

Description NewLimit is seeking a Computational Biologist to join our Predict team. In this role ... Strong software engineering fundamentals and experience working with bioinformatics tools and ...

next page

Showing results 1-20

Computational Engineering information

See California salary details

$47.9K

$119.9K

$135.7K

How much do computational engineering jobs pay per year?

As of Jun 26, 2026, the average yearly pay for computational engineering in California is $119,924.00, according to ZipRecruiter salary data. Most workers in this role earn between $110,000.00 and $129,800.00 per year, depending on experience, location, and employer.

Can computer engineers make $500,000?

Computer engineers can potentially earn $500,000 or more annually, especially with advanced skills in areas like software development, systems architecture, or cybersecurity, and in senior or executive roles. Achieving this level often requires extensive experience, specialized certifications, and working in high-paying industries or companies. Such salaries are more common in senior positions, consulting, or entrepreneurial ventures within the tech field.

What are the key skills and qualifications needed to thrive in the Computational Engineering position, and why are they important?

To thrive as a Computational Engineer, a strong background in mathematics, computer science, and engineering fundamentals is essential, generally supported by a degree in computational engineering or a related field. Familiarity with programming languages like Python, MATLAB, or C++, as well as experience using simulation software and high-performance computing systems, is typically required. Analytical thinking, effective communication, and problem-solving abilities are important soft skills for collaboration and innovation. These competencies enable Computational Engineers to develop accurate models, optimize complex systems, and deliver efficient solutions in multidisciplinary environments.

What engineers make $500,000?

Senior engineers in specialized fields such as software engineering, petroleum engineering, and aerospace engineering can earn $500,000 or more annually, especially with experience, advanced skills, and leadership roles. High compensation often includes bonuses, stock options, or profit sharing, particularly in technology and energy sectors.

What can you do with a computational engineering degree?

A computational engineering degree prepares individuals for roles involving modeling, simulation, and analysis of complex systems across industries such as aerospace, automotive, energy, and manufacturing. Graduates often work as simulation engineers, data analysts, or software developers, utilizing tools like MATLAB, Python, or C++ and applying skills in mathematics, programming, and systems design.

What are some common challenges Computational Engineers face in their work?

Computational Engineers often encounter complex, large-scale problems that require developing accurate and efficient computational models, which can be challenging due to intricacies in physical systems or computational resource limitations. Managing tight project deadlines while ensuring high-quality results and adapting to rapidly evolving technology are also common aspects of the role. Collaboration across multidisciplinary teams—often with scientists, designers, or other engineers—requires strong communication and adaptability. Embracing these challenges can help Computational Engineers expand their expertise and positively impact project outcomes.

What is a Computational Engineering job?

A Computational Engineering job involves using mathematical models, algorithms, and computer simulations to analyze and solve engineering problems. It combines principles from computer science, applied mathematics, and engineering to improve product design, optimize systems, and enhance efficiency in various industries. Professionals in this field develop software tools, conduct simulations, and utilize high-performance computing to solve complex engineering challenges in areas such as aerospace, automotive, energy, and healthcare.

What engineers make $300,000 a year?

Senior engineers in specialized fields such as software engineering, petroleum engineering, and certain roles in aerospace or nuclear engineering can earn $300,000 or more annually, especially with extensive experience, advanced skills, and leadership responsibilities. High compensation often involves working in high-demand industries, holding advanced degrees, or obtaining professional certifications.
What are the most commonly searched types of Computational Engineering jobs in California? The most popular types of Computational Engineering jobs in California are:
What are popular job titles related to Computational Engineering jobs in California? For Computational Engineering jobs in California, the most frequently searched job titles are:
Computational Engineering Associate

Computational Engineering Associate

Stanford University

Stanford, CA

$91K - $119K/yr

Other

Posted 27 days ago


Stanford University rating

7.8

Company rating: 7.8 out of 10

Based on 24 frontline employees who took The Breakroom Quiz

196th of 539 rated colleges and universities


Job description

The Cardiovascular Biomechanics Computation Lab at Stanford University, led by Dr. Alison Marsden, focuses on computational modeling of the cardiovascular system to aid surgical planning, medical device design, and fundamental research in biomechanics. The lab develops the SimVascular open-source project, a leading tool for patient-specific modeling and blood flow simulation, and manages the Vascular Model Repository (VMR), which offers over 300 accessible SimVascular-compatible projects.

The lab seeks a Computational Engineering Associate to support VMR (https://vascularmodel.com) and SimVascular projects (https://simvascular.github.io). through data curation, database management, website maintenance, open-source software development-including bug reporting and documentation-and creating Python scripts for data processing in AI and machine learning applications. The role involves collaborating with Stanford libraries to ensure data integrity and integration of new datasets into the VMR, as well as maintaining comprehensive documentation for accessibility to researchers.

The ideal candidate will work closely with lab members and external collaborators, possessing programming experience (e.g., Python), excellent communication skills, a collaborative mindset, and project management capabilities.

Duties include:

       Data Curation for VMR: Manage data repository activities, including data archiving, curation, and ensuring public access for various research projects, while facilitating dissemination to the scientific community.

      Support for SimVascular: Assist with bug reporting, source code testing, and documentation, as well as providing user support and troubleshooting for the SimVascular community, ensuring effective dissemination of software releases.

     Model Building: Utilize SimVascular and 3D Slicer to develop anatomical models from medical images, enhancing the research database and promoting model accessibility to researchers.

       Project Management: Assist the PI with overseeing ongoing research projects and assist the senior software engineer with oversight of open-source projects, ensuring timely completion of scientific tasks and collaboration among team members, while supporting the dissemination of findings to the broader scientific community. 

      Lab Management: Assist with lab operations including compute resource allocation, equipment purchases, and onboarding new members to support scientific computing activities.

     Workflow Development: Create custom Python scripts to facilitate machine learning, data curation, and patient-specific modeling processes, aiding in the dissemination of innovative methods and tools.

* - Other duties may also be assigned

Stanford University provides pay ranges representing its good faith estimate of what the University reasonably expects to pay for a position. The pay offered to a selected candidate will be determined based on factors such as (but not limited to) the scope and responsibilities of the position, the qualifications of the selected candidate, departmental budget availability, internal equity, geographic location, and external market pay for comparable jobs. The pay range for this position working in the California Bay area is $91,339.00 to $119,362.00 annually.

DESIRED QUALIFICATIONS:

EDUCATION & EXPERIENCE (REQUIRED):

Bachelor's degree in engineering, science, or related field and three years of relevant experience; or a combination of education and relevant experience.

KNOWLEDGE, SKILLS AND ABILITIES (REQUIRED):

       Advanced Scientific and Engineering Knowledge: Strong understanding of scientific and engineering principles, with practical experience using engineering and simulation software such as CAD and finite element analysis tools.

       Programming and Software Engineering Proficiency: Demonstrated skills in Python programming and software engineering through coursework, research, or industry experience, including tasks like data format conversion, workflow automation, and developing scripts for AI applications.

       Open-Source Engagement: Commitment to contributing to open-source initiatives, including effective use of GitHub for source code version control, issue tracking, and collaboration with development teams.

       Team Collaboration and Technical Support: Experience working with teams to troubleshoot software installations and support laboratory operations while ensuring compliance with health and safety standards.

       Organizational Skills: Employ strong organizational skills to support collaboration with senior staff in developing custom software solutions and coordinating research initiatives.

CERTIFICATIONS & LICENSES:

None

PHYSICAL REQUIREMENTS*:

       Frequently grasp lightly/fine manipulation, perform desk-based computer tasks, lift/carry/push/pull objects that weigh up to 10 pounds.

       Occasionally stand/walk, sit, twist/bend/stoop/squat, grasp forcefully.

       Rarely kneel/crawl, climb (ladders, scaffolds, or other), reach/work above shoulders, use a telephone, writing by hand, sort/file paperwork or parts, operate foot and/or hand controls, lift/carry/push/pull objects that weigh >40 pounds.

       Consistent with its obligations under the law, the University will provide reasonable accommodation to any employee with a disability who requires accommodation to perform the essential functions of his or her job.

WORKING CONDITIONS:

       May be exposed to high voltage electricity, radiation or electromagnetic fields, lasers, noise > 80dB TWA, Allergens/Biohazards/Chemicals /Asbestos, confined spaces, working at heights 10 feet, temperature extremes, heavy metals, unusual work hours or routine overtime and/or inclement weather.

       May require travel.

Additional Information
  • Schedule: Full-time
  • Job Code: 4991
  • Employee Status: Regular
  • Grade: I
  • Department URL: http://pediatrics.stanford.edu/
  • Requisition ID: 109358
  • Work Arrangement : On Site

What Stanford University employees say

Pay

Benefits

Hours and flexibility

Workplace

Get the full story on Breakroom